Regeneration in Citrullus colocynthis collected from EL- Wadi EI-Gadid region as a medicinal plant has been achieved through the disorganized culture (callus). Results silo wedl that tile best explants fur calius furmation were; the coryledun and hypocoryledon when, cultured on MS+ 0..1 mg/L kinetin + different concentrations of 2, 4-D + 0.8 % agar + 3 " sucrose at pH 5.8. This medium induced a golden callus at 20 'C and 1000 lux for 8 hr/16 hr light /dark period. The best medium for plantlet regeneration from callus was MS + 0.1 mg/ L 1AA + different concentrations of 6 BA + 0.8 % agar + 3 % sucrose at pH (5.7) under conditions of 30c. 1500 lux and 10 hr light / Uhr dark period. It was shown that maximum regeneration capacity for one callus was 59 R. planets. Rooting medium consisted of % MS + different concentrations of NAA + 0.7 % agar + 3 % sucrose at pH (5.7). The in vitro regeneration of this plant would prevent its eradication due to expansion of housing in its area of natural growth.
